Meanings of Wrong
Adjective
-
Not correct or true.
-
Not good or fair; bad.
-
Not suitable for the situation.
-
Not working properly.
Verb
-
To treat someone unfairly or hurt them.
-
To take away someone's rights or not be fair to them.
Noun
-
Something that is not good or fair.
-
A mistake or something that hurts someone.
-
The opposite of right; something bad.
Adverb
-
In a way that is not correct.
Explanation of the word: Wrong
Wrong means something is not correct or not the way it should be. For example, if you say 2 plus 2 is 5, that's wrong because 2 plus 2 is actually 4.

Frequently Asked Questions about the word: Wrong
The word 'wrong' means something that is not right or correct. It can also mean something that is unfair or bad.
You pronounce 'wrong' like this: 'rong' (it rhymes with 'song').
The word 'wrong' comes from an old English word 'wrang', which means 'crooked' or 'twisted'.
